At its core, betmatch involves identifying discrepancies in odds offered by different bookmakers and capitalizing on them. This isn’t simply finding the 'best' odds; it’s about finding odds that, when combined, guarantee a profit regardless of the outcome of the event. This requires a keen eye for detail, quick decision-making, and access to tools that can rapidly compare odds across multiple platforms. While the potential rewards are significant, it’s also important to recognize that successful betmatching is not a 'get-rich-quick' scheme and requires dedication, discipline, and continuous learning.
Understanding the Fundamentals of Value Betting
Before diving deeper into the specifics of betmatch, it's essential to grasp the underlying principle of value betting. Value betting isn't about predicting the outcome of an event; it's about identifying situations where the odds offered by a bookmaker are higher than the perceived probability of that outcome occurring. This perceived probability is often determined through independent analysis, statistical modeling, or a combination of both. If you consistently identify and bet on value, the law of large numbers suggests you will be profitable in the long run. However, this requires a methodical approach and an ability to avoid emotional biases. Understanding how the bookmakers set their odds, and where they are likely to make mistakes, is a cornerstone of effective value investing.
Many bettors focus solely on the excitement of the sport itself. Value bettors, however, take a more detached, analytical approach. They treat betting as an investment opportunity, focusing on return on investment (ROI) rather than simply hoping for a winning bet. This requires a robust understanding of statistics, probability, and risk management. Furthermore, successful value bettors are often proficient in using spreadsheets or specialized software to track their bets, analyze their performance, and identify areas for improvement. They're not afraid to admit mistakes and learn from them.
The Role of Arbitrage Calculators
Arbitrage calculators are invaluable tools for anyone involved in betmatch. These calculators automatically determine the optimal stake for each outcome of an event, ensuring a guaranteed profit. They take into account the odds offered by different bookmakers and calculate the necessary investments to cover all possible results. Accurate input is critical when using these calculators – even a small error can negate the arbitrage opportunity. Many online resources offer free arbitrage calculators, but it’s important to choose a reputable one that is regularly updated and known for its accuracy. Don’t solely rely on automated tools; always double-check the calculations manually to confirm the potential profit.
The speed at which odds change means that being able to quickly calculate and place bets is essential. Some arbitrage calculators are integrated with betting exchange platforms, allowing for automated bet placement. However, using automated tools can be risky, as they may not always function as expected and could lead to unexpected losses. It’s therefore crucial to understand the limitations of these tools and to always maintain manual oversight.

Identifying and Utilizing Multiple Bookmakers
Successful betmatching fundamentally relies on having accounts with a diverse range of bookmakers. Different bookmakers cater to different markets and exhibit varying degrees of efficiency in setting their odds. Some bookmakers are known for offering competitive odds on major sporting events, while others specialize in niche sports or leagues. The more bookmakers you have access to, the greater your chances of finding arbitrage opportunities and value bets. Furthermore, having multiple accounts mitigates the risk of being limited or restricted by a single bookmaker. This is particularly important for successful bettors who consistently win.
However, managing multiple bookmaker accounts can be time-consuming and require diligent record-keeping. It’s essential to track your bets across all platforms, monitor your balance, and ensure that you comply with the terms and conditions of each bookmaker. Some bookmakers restrict access to certain features or bonuses for users who engage in arbitrage betting. Always read the fine print and be aware of any potential limitations. Consider using a dedicated betting tracker to streamline this process and avoid errors.

Risk Management Techniques in Betmatching
While betmatch aims to eliminate risk, it's crucial to understand that it's not entirely risk-free. There are several factors that can jeopardize your potential profit, including changes in odds, bet placement errors, and account restrictions. Effective risk management is therefore paramount. This involves setting a budget, limiting your stake sizes, and diversifying your bets. Avoid chasing losses and always stick to your pre-defined strategy. Emotional betting can quickly lead to poor decision-making and significant financial losses.
One common risk is known as ‘stake drifting’. This occurs when the odds shift slightly after you have placed one part of an arbitrage bet but before you can place the other. This can significantly reduce your potential profit or even result in a loss. To mitigate this risk, it’s important to act quickly and use tools that can rapidly compare odds and execute bets. Another risk is the possibility of a bookmaker voiding a bet due to a technical error or a rule violation. Always read the bookmaker’s rules carefully and be prepared for unexpected situations.
Implementing a Bankroll Management Strategy
A robust bankroll management strategy is the foundation of long-term success in betmatching. A common approach is to allocate a fixed percentage of your bankroll to each bet. For example, you might decide to risk no more than 1% of your bankroll on any single bet. This helps to minimize your losses and protect your capital during losing streaks. It's also important to track your ROI and adjust your stake sizes accordingly. If you’re consistently profitable, you might consider increasing your stake sizes slightly, but always do so cautiously and responsibly.
Avoid the temptation to increase your stakes in an attempt to recover losses. This is a classic mistake that can quickly escalate into a significant financial crisis. Stick to your pre-defined strategy, even during challenging periods. Consistent discipline and patience are essential for success in betmatching. Remember that it’s a marathon, not a sprint.

Navigating the Evolving Landscape of Betting Regulations
The regulatory landscape surrounding online betting is constantly changing, and it’s important to stay informed of the latest developments. Different countries and regions have different rules and regulations governing online gambling, and these regulations can impact your ability to engage in betmatching. Some jurisdictions may prohibit arbitrage betting altogether, while others may impose restrictions on the types of bets you can place or the amounts you can wager. It’s your responsibility to ensure that you comply with all applicable laws and regulations. Failure to do so could result in fines, account closures, or even legal prosecution.
The increasing scrutiny of online betting by regulatory authorities is also leading to tighter restrictions on bookmakers. This can make it more difficult to find arbitrage opportunities and may lead to more frequent account limitations. It’s therefore crucial to adapt to the changing landscape and to remain vigilant about protecting your betting accounts.
